Moroccan firm wants  Air Malawi dissolved

Moroccan firm wants Air Malawi dissolved

A Moroccan company, which overhauled an engine for Air Malawi 737 500 in 2007, has applied to the Commercial Division of the High Court of Malawi for the winding up of the airline over an unpaid debt of over K500 million for the services.
